The Pakistan Accord recently organised the second round of capacity-building training for government officials in Sindh and Punjab, reaffirming our commitment to enhancing building and fire safety standards. 📍 𝗞𝗮𝗿𝗮𝗰𝗵𝗶 (𝗠𝗮𝗿𝗰𝗵 𝟭𝟬-𝟭𝟭) Over 50 participants from eight key government departments attended the workshop in Karachi, including, the Sindh Building Control Authority (SBCA), Department of Labour and Human Resources, Rescue 1122, Civil Defense, K-Electric, Fire Brigade, NED University, Fire Protection Association. Mr. Rajvir Singh Sodha, Provincial Minister for Human Rights, and Mr. Muhammad Ishaq Khuhro, DG SBCA, attended the closing session as special guests. 📍 𝗟𝗮𝗵𝗼𝗿𝗲 (𝗠𝗮𝗿𝗰𝗵 𝟭𝟮-𝟭𝟯) Over 60 officials attended the workshop in Lahore. The organisations in attendance included the Department of Labour and Human Resources, Punjab Emergency Services, Lahore and Faisalabad Development Authorities, Civil Defense, LESCO, UET, and NESPAK. Dr Rizwan Naseer, a renowned fire safety expert and Sitara-e-Imtiaz awardee, was the Chief Guest. He also presented certificates to the participants. 📚 Led by Ms. Vita Sanderson & Ms. Laura from Arup, the sessions covered essential structural and fire safety principles, providing government officials with critical insights. 🔹 This initiative builds on the intensive capacity-building training conducted in February 2025. #PakistanAccord #WorkplaceSafety #WorkerSafety | Zulfiqar Shah
